We spent the first hour crossing off 2 target fields. The crop-marks we are guessing are Bronze Age, & not of interest to us, so time to move on.
I had a plan & Cru'dad had a plan, as it happens I think he made the right strategy choice in the end. I wasn't that keen on this Roman Site, as it's a low yield site with our best coin count in any 1 year being 8 scrappies.
He had scouted this field for 1 hour this week & got 1 scrappy & a Roman Spoon Bowl, pictured with today's finds;
(4.5 hours)
13 Roman Coins (1 good one of Allectus Galley type, found by Cru'dad OTWBTTC) Best year off this field
Roman Spoon Bowl
Post Medieval Spur Bit
Tudor Book Mount
1590-92 Lizzy Halfgroat (Cru'dads 2 dig - kiss off death, but keeping the streak alive)
